A Seriously Funny Email Exchange

This pretty much speaks for itself but just in case, this is an email exchange between me and a guy I used to know briefly a long time ago when we were both young Marines. I've hidden his name just to be nice. We'll call him .... Bill.

(Please read to the end, it's classic)

----------------------

Hi Jason,

On this rather quiet afternoon here at the office I decided to Google a few names of fellow jarheads from way back. So I entered Brian Rebello, and ended up on your site.

With great interest I read your Gulf War pages and checked out the pictures ... I found a lot of familiar names there: Mabe, Machowski, Accord, Mortensen. I remember those guys from the '89 & '90 Westpacs out of Yuma I went on.

Why am I thinking we met? (I'll be 40 this year so forgive my failin' memory) Anyway, I saw the pic of your wonderful family. See if I look familiar: (website removed).

Sincerely,

Bill
----------------------

Bill,

Yes, we were in 650 together but you left shortly after I arrived. You went on float but before that, I remember a shop party where we went out somewhere and had a bon fire and afterwards had a late night dinner at a western-style restaurant in town, as a drunk group. You pissed off your girlfriend by going on about the general attractiveness of my wife (ha).

Anyway, here are some updates of people you might/might not have known:

Mark Seymon just retired a First Sergeant after 23 years. He, his wife, and three daughters live in Jacksonville, NC. He is selling cars now.

Brandon Scott is now a Gunny and runs 650 in Cherry Pitt. Currently he is in Iraq.

Mike Machowski now runs 650 in Yuma. I think he's a Gunny too.

Eric Baarstad got out and is now a techrep for 650 in Yuma.

Sal Corvo just retired from techrep'in. He was in Cherry Point and Mark says he was EXACTLY as he ALWAYS was even this many years later: serious, driven, white smock, a variety of tiny tools in his breast pocket, and willing to jump into any piece of gear. Mark said that when Mark retired, Sal came up to him and simply said he was proud of him and to Mark, this was the biggest praise he had ever received.

Brian Rebello is out and married a Mormon. Deep into it as I hear.

Mike Mabe got out and as I hear, married an absolute knock-out.

Benny Accord is out and Shane recently heard from him that he's doing OK.

Bo Mortenson is also out and I think he's working for his dad in Phoenix. Shane talked to him recently and he is a self-professed "big fat guy" but still does the drinking and skirt-chasing. Same old Bo.

Rob Doyle (620) got out after the war and is now a doctor.

I don't know if you knew Shane Maxey (big mean red-headed freckled DI). If so, he got out and finished up his career in the Army and now resides in Boise running their National Guard unit.

I stayed in 650 until after the war, did a MEU-SOC pump, and then got picked up for the MECEP program as a Sergeant. I went to UW in Seattle, got commissioned, and was assigned as the Adjutant for First Tank Battalion. I then moved up to Regiment (7th Marines) before getting hooked up with the Special Education Program where they sent me to the Naval Postgraduate School in Monterey, CA for two years. Came out with a master's in IT and am now halfway through a 4 year payback tour in Quantico as a program manager for a web-based training tracking program for Training and Education Command, Formal Schools Training Branch. This leads me right up to retirement in 2007 when I'll head back to Seattle and get a picked fence for my wife and two kids.
